BUSINESS NEWS

  • Gage Cannabis will close 20 dispensaries and four grow operations in Michigan by September, which will cut about 250 jobs from the state. The company said it is leaving Michigan to focus on markets like New Jersey, Pennsylvania, Maryland, and Ohio — aiming for better returns.  WJIM AM
  • Costco announced it has recalled several household items sold in Michigan, including window air conditioners prone to mold, tires at risk for detachment, adjustable dumbbells with loose weight plates, and power banks with battery overheating concerns+ Michigan customers are urged to stop using these products immediately and return them for a full refund at their local store.  WJIM AM
  • Walmart announced a recall of 850,000 Ozark Trail 64-oz insulated water bottles sold in Michigan since 2017 after defective lids — which may explode when storing liquid — injured users and caused one permanent vision loss. Customers should stop using these bottles and return them to Walmart for a full refund.  WJIM AM

CRIME NEWS

  • The FBI has warned Michigan residents that scammers pose as savvy investors to promote fake stock trading groups and trick people into buying stocks of low value—then sell their shares and vanish, leaving victims with worthless investments.  WJIM AM
  • The Michigan Supreme Court ruled on July 12 that Jennifer Crumbley must remain in prison as her request for bond was denied—upholding the lower court decision on her involuntary manslaughter convictions linked to the Oxford High School shooting.  WKAR

CULTURE NEWS

  • ScrapFest returned to Old Town Lansing this weekend with teams collecting up to 500 pounds of scrap metal to create nearly 50 sculptures for the free festival. The annual event featured live entertainment, vendors, and food trucks—proceeds benefiting the local Old Town Commercial Association—attracting thousands from Lansing and nearby.  WJIM AM

GOVERNMENT NEWS

  • Michigan law now restricts legal fireworks use to set days including the weekends before Memorial and Labor Day, June 29 to July 4, if July 5 falls on a Friday or Saturday, and December 31 until 1 am on January 1—fireworks are allowed only between 11 am and 11:45 pm. Violating these rules may lead to fines up to $1,000 and some local areas enforce extra restrictions.  WJIM AM

HEALTH NEWS

  • Orkin’s 2025 Top 50 Bed Bug Cities List shows four Michigan cities ranked among the worst—Detroit at No. 3, Grand Rapids at No. 7, Flint at No. 16, and Lansing at No. 48. Health experts urge residents to inspect beds, furniture, and secondhand items to help prevent bed bug infestations.  Lansing State Journal
  • Mondelez voluntarily recalled misbranded Ritz Peanut Butter Cracker Sandwiches in Michigan after some wrappers mistakenly show cheese instead of peanut butter, posing a risk for those with peanut allergies—customers should check products with best-by dates from November 1 to 9 and January 2 to 22 and return them for a refund.  WJIM AM
